Let me tell you, playing Munchkin with five decks (basic, Muchkin Bites, Munchkin Fu, Super Munchkin, and Muchkin Blender) takes a long time: three and a half hours for one game with six players. I had the same experience with a marathon all-decks Munchkin game at GenCon a couple years ago that went until around 3 AM (lasting nearly five hours).

The thing in both cases was, no matter how much the game wore on or how tired (or drunk, in the latter case) anyone got, nobody was willing to let the game end if it meant someone else winning, and everyone stayed in so long as there was a chance to screw with the other players.

Well done, Steve Jackson Games. Muchkin captures its genre perfectly. Mission accomplished.
